2016-05-04 17 views
0

Ich benutze Google Maps API mit meiner Android App und es zeigt nichts als leere Karten.Android - Google Maps API zeigt keine Karten an

Here ist der Screenshot.

Ich habe einen API-Schlüssel von Google-Entwickler erhalten und in google_maps_api.xml sowohl in Debug-und Release-Version eingefügt.

<string name="google_maps_key" translatable="false" templateMergeStrategy="preserve"> 
     AIzaSyCAiL844hgfM2S_kDApCrITIzj-S5wgBzA 
</string> 

ich registriert meine App auf Google-Entwickler auch Screenshot

Konto tun Ich habe nichts mit den Karten, sondern nur den MapsActivity von Assistenten ausgewählt.

Berechtigungen:

<uses-permission android:name="android.permission.INTERNET" /> 
<uses-permission android:name="android.permission.ACCESS_NETWORK_STATE" /> 
<uses-permission android:name="android.permission.WRITE_EXTERNAL_STORAGE" /> 
<uses-permission android:name="com.google.android.providers.gsf.permission.READ_GSERVICES" /> 
+0

Ist 'android: name =" android.permission.WRITE_EXTERNAL_STORAGE "' als eine Erlaubnis in Ihrem Manifest hinzugefügt? – Slim

+0

Problem ist create MAP_KEY Bitte folgen Sie diesem Link und erstellen Sie arbeiten für mich. (Https://developers.google.com/maps/documentation/android-api/start) –

+0

@VishalPatolia bitte lesen Sie die Frage. Ich habe MAPS Schlüssel –

Antwort

1

Es gibt ein paar Gründe, warum Ihr Google Map nicht nichts zeigt, ist.

Sie müssen etwas wie dieses setzen A5: 1A: 89: 84: A9: 5C: B7: 13: 6D: 7C: 28: 20: C5: 65: A4: F4: 97: E4: 98: 99 ; co.mipackage.example. Die Nummer, in meinem Fall A5: 1A: 89: 84: A9: 5C: B7: 13: 6D: 7C: 28: 20: C5: 65: A4: F4: 97: E4: 98: 99 müssen zugewiesen sein Nummer für Ihren Computer, so müssen Sie sehen, ob es korrekt ist. Der Pfad des Pakets muss auch stimmen.

+0

Können Sie erklären? Wie? –

+0

Ich habe diesen Schritt schon gemacht. Bitte werfen Sie einen Blick hier http://prntscr.com/b06jjt –

0

Nun, vielen Dank für Anregungen, aber ich habe mein Problem gelöst.

Problem war mit meinem Paketnamen war es com.example.picturetrackerapp in meinem Projekt wurde aber als com.example.picturetracker auf google developers account registriert. Ich änderte es und mein Problem gelöst

+0

Great !. Können Sie meine Antwort wählen, schrieb ich "Der Weg des Pakets muss auch stimmen" Dank im Voraus. –